Avena fatua L. subsp. fatua v. glabrata Peterm. subv. pseudo-basifixa Thell. as a source of crown rust resistance genes
Authors:J ?ebesta  F Kühn
Institution:(1) Plant Protection Division, Research Institute for Crop Production, 161 06 Prague 6, Ruzynecaron 507, Czechoslovakia;(2) University of Agriculture, Zemecarondecaronlská 1, 613 00 Brno, Czechoslovakia
Abstract:Summary An accession of Avena fatua L. subsp. fatua v. glabrata Peterm. subv. pseudo-basifixa Thell. (A. fatua L. CS Sel. No. 1), collected in Czechoslovakia in 1971, was found to be resistant to a wide range of crown rust races. Analyses of crosses of this oat with cvs. Weikuss, Leanda, Mona, Rodney A, Rodney B, Rodney M, Dodge and K 316 indicated that the resistance of A. fatua CS Sel. No. 1 is conditioned by one recessive gene which is in interaction with one partially dominant gene with additive effect. The expression of rust reaction was affected by temperature. The crown rust resistance genes of A. fatua L. CS Sel. No. 1 were non-allelic with stem rust resistance genes Pg-2 (A) and Pg-4(B).
